FC Utrecht has released an option in Jens Toornstra's contract

Jens Toornstra will also play for FC Utrecht next season, the Domstedelingen confirm via official channels. Technical director Jordy Zuidam has removed the one-year option from the 35-year-old midfielder's contract. Despite his age, Toornstra is still of great value to Utrecht, which is pleased with his stay at Galgenwaard Stadium.

KNVB suspends Peer Koopmeiners for three matches after red card

The KNVB has imposed a three-match suspension on Peer Koopmeiners, one of which is conditional. The Almere City midfielder received a direct red card in the final phase of the match against SC Heerenveen and will have to watch for the rest of the season.

This also means that Koopmeiners has played his last game in the shirt of Almere City, as he will return next season to AZ, which rented him out this season. He still has a contract in Alkmaar until mid-2025. This season he did not score in 30 league matches for Almere City, but he did provide eight assists.

Igor Paixão may be available again against PEC Zwolle

Feyenoord striker Igor Paixão was back on the field on Thursday during the public training of the Rotterdam team at the 1908 training complex. The 23-year-old Brazilian, who scored the winning goal in the cup final against NEC Nijmegen (1-0 win), had to play the away game with Go Ahead Eagles (1-3 win) missed last week. Now Paixão seems fit enough to play minutes again on Sunday evening (8 p.m.) against PEC Zwolle in De Kuip.

Parma returns to Serie A after three seasons

Parma can be admired again at the highest level in Italy next season. I Crociati needed exactly one point on Wednesday evening and that was what they achieved: 1-1 when they visited Bari. Parma is therefore assured of a place in the top two in Serie B, which entitles them to direct promotion. The club last played in Serie A in the 2020/21 season.

LFC Foundation can credit record amount after charity match

The charity match between the Liverpool Legends and Ajax Legends raised a record amount. On March 23, the former players of Liverpool and Ajax faced each other at Anfield, with the English winning 4-2. The charity match raised a record amount of no less than 1.2 million pounds, approximately 1.4 million euros, for the LFC Foundation. In addition, almost sixty thousand spectators attended the match, which is also a record for a charity match the Reds

David Nascimento new head coach FC Den Bosch

David Nascimento will be the trainer of the main squad of FC Den Bosch from July 1, 2024. The Portuguese-Cape Verdean former professional footballer of RKC Waalwijk, FC Utrecht and Sparta, among others, signs a contract for two seasons with the Bossche first division team. Ulrich Landvreugd (52) is also making the switch to FC Den Bosch. The current head coach of SC Telstar has been appointed as assistant coach for the same period.

After his active playing career, David Nascimento held various positions in (international) professional football. For example, he was head of youth development at the South African Memelodi Sundowns and technical director at Apoel FC in Cyprus. Nascimento took the first steps in his coaching career in the youth academy of Sparta Rotterdam, where he was also interim head coach.

Nascimento interned for seven months at Louis van Gaal's AZ and worked as an assistant coach at FC Utrecht and Chivas Guadalajara in Mexico. In Mexico and South Africa, Nascimento had the task of implementing Johan Cruijff's football vision. Nascimento last worked in the Netherlands as head coach of FC Eindhoven. Since then he has been national coach of the Jordanian women's team.

“I really wanted to be a trainer again at a club in the Netherlands, the country where I started my coaching career,” says Nascimento on the Den Bosch club website. “I am very pleased that FC Den Bosch has become that club. It's a great club, with fantastic supporters. As a football player I often played in De Vliert. I think that my character and football vision fit in well with what the people of Den Bosch want, namely to see attacking football with fight as a basis. FC Den Bosch still counts. Our ambition is to translate the impetus from the sporting glory days and the enthusiasm from the stands to the field. I will do my best for that.”

Hans van Breukelen presents a bowl at the PSV championship

PSV can become Dutch champions on Sunday at 12:15 PM in their own Phillips Stadium. Peter Bosz's team only needs a draw. If the Eindhoven team succeeds, captain Luuk de Jong will receive the bowl from former PSV goalkeeper Hans van Breukelen after the match.

Cambuur leaves supporters at home for the match against Roda JC to make a statement

SC Cambuur will travel to Kerkrade without supporters on Friday for the match against Roda JC. The Leeuwarders announced this on Monday. Cambuur believes that the local triangle in Kerkrade applies 'supporter-unfriendly' conditions, which gives fans unpleasant experiences. For example, away matches at Roda can only be attended by a special bus combination, which forces fans to wait in the stadium for at least an hour after the end of the match in question.

Deadline passed: three potential association presidents left for KNVB

Jeanet van der Laan, Hans Nijland or Frank Paauw will become the new chairman of the KNVB. After the deadline has passed, only the above three are still in the race to succeed Just Spee. On May 27, sixty KNVB members (thirty representatives from amateur football and thirty from professional football) will democratically decide who will win the chairmanship of the association. Jorien van den Herik was initially also in the race, but withdrew at the last minute.

Steven Bergwijn hears suspension after red card against Excelsior

The KNVB has imposed a one-match suspension on Steven Bergwijn following his red card in the match against Excelsior (2-2). After half an hour of play, the Ajax attacker pulled the broken Mimeirhel Benita to the grass, after which referee Sander van der Eijk decided to draw the red card after studying the images.

Bergwijn will therefore have to miss Ajax's next match, which will be Ajax's away match against FC Volendam on Sunday, May 5. Bergwijn will be available again for the last two competition matches, against Almere City FC and Vitesse.

Ambitious Canada is eyeing two former PL coaches

Canada has expressed its interest in Ole Gunnar Solskjaer and American Jesse Marsch for the role of national coach, it is known TheStandard to report. The former Manchester United coach is favored to lead Canada at the 2026 World Cup. He has been without a club since his dismissal in 2021; the same goes for Marsch. The American was head coach of Leeds United in the 2022/23 season, but only lasted until February due to disappointing results.

Canada previously made attempts to convince Frank Lampard and José Mourinho to become national coaches the Canucks, but that turned out to be in vain. The Canadian football team, which includes Jonathan David and Alphonso Davies, is currently guided by interim coach Mauro Biello.

Supporters association Go Ahead Eagles congratulates Feyenoord after cup victory

The supporters' association of the Go Ahead Eagles congratulated Feyenoord in a fun way for winning the TOTO KNVB Cup against NEC last Sunday: 1-0.

The match between Go Ahead and Feyenoord is scheduled for Thursday evening, but the traveling supporters of the Rotterdam team do not have to worry that they will end up with an empty stomach. “On our behalf, two drinks for the away section to enjoy this match. We would like to come to you, and you would like to come to us. Next time we would like to toast together,” the website reads.
